Hardware Features The serial number label for Cisco 2821 and Cisco 2851 routers is located on the rear of the chassis, near the top right corner, below the CLEI label. (See Figure 6.) Cisco Product Identification Tool The Cisco Product Identification (CPI) tool provides detailed illustrations and descriptions showing where to locate serial number labels on Cisco products. It includes the following features: • A search option that allows browsing for models using a tree-structured product hierarchy • A search field on the final results page making it easier to look up multiple products • End-of-sale products are clearly identified in results lists The tool streamlines the process of locating serial number labels and identifying products. Serial number information expedites the entitlement process and is important for access to support services.
